Outdoor sofa cushions can sometimes develop an unpleasant plastic odor, especially when exposed to heat or humidity. To keep your cushions smelling fresh, start by airing them out regularly. Remove the covers and let them breathe in a shaded, well-ventilated area for a few hours.
Washing the cushion covers with mild detergent and baking soda can also help neutralize odors. For deeper cleaning, sprinkle baking soda directly on the cushions, let it sit for 15-20 minutes, then vacuum it off. Avoid using harsh chemicals, as they can worsen the smell or damage the fabric.
Storing cushions properly is key. Keep them in a cool, dry place when not in use, and avoid sealing them in plastic bags, which can trap moisture and intensify odors. Opt for breathable storage containers instead.
